Floor Joist Repair in Wilmington, NC
Floor joist repair services focus on restoring the structural integrity of the horizontal supports that hold up floors in residential properties. These repairs are essential when joists become damaged due to wood rot, termite infestation, moisture issues, or age-related wear. Projects may include replacing or reinforcing existing joists, addressing sagging floors, or fixing issues caused by shifting or settling foundations. Property owners typically seek this service to ensure their floors are safe, level, and stable, especially after noticing uneven surfaces, creaking sounds, or visible sagging.

Floor Joist Repair Questions
What are signs of damaged floor joists? Indicators include sagging floors, creaking sounds, or visible gaps between flooring and walls.
Can damaged floor joists affect a home's safety? Yes, compromised joists can lead to structural issues and should be evaluated promptly.
What types of repair methods are common for floor joist issues? Repairs may involve sistering, reinforcement, or replacement of damaged joists depending on the extent of damage.
Is it necessary to replace all floor joists if only some are damaged? Not always; only the affected joists need repair or replacement, but a thorough inspection is recommended to determine the scope.
